The used Electro-Voice 660 is a supercardioid dynamic microphone designed for broadcast, speech, and professional vocal recording applications. Thanks to the renowned, patented Variable-D™ technology, this model maintains a natural tonal response even when used very close to the sound source, eliminating the typical proximity effect characteristic of many traditional dynamic microphones.
The EV 660 delivers clear and balanced vocal reproduction thanks to the Acoustalloy diaphragm developed by Electro-Voice. This material ensures a uniform frequency response, high long-term reliability, and remarkable resistance to weather and humidity, making it ideal for both fixed installations and heavy-duty use.
One of this microphone’s long-standing strengths is the Variable-D™ system, designed to drastically reduce low-frequency variation caused by distance from the microphone. The result is a more natural, controlled, and easily manageable voice during recordings, radio broadcasts, and speech applications.

The internal structure employs a shock-resistant design that effectively protects the capsule from accidental impacts. The die-cast zinc body with a satin chrome finish ensures sturdiness and long-lasting durability even in particularly demanding professional environments.
